Will MTN's On Air radio conference address SA music industry?

13 Mar 2014 9:28 AM

With the MTN Radio Awards coming up shortly, MTN have added the On Air radio Conference to their events list. The conference will focus on radio, featuring panel debates on trends and will examine the challenges and difficulties that radio needs to overcome.

One of these challenges, I'm sure, will be the mounting competition to traditional radio in the form of online streaming radio or internet radio, and the plethora of choice that listeners will have in a few years to come. How will they hold on to their loyal listeners? 
 
While unlikely, I'd like to see the conference address the quota of South African music on commercial radio stations, and perhaps a discussion on how they could support the SA music industry more effectively. 
 
Debates and discussions
 
The On Air radio conference will take place at the Michelangelo Hotel from 10am until 2pm in Sandton on Friday, 11 April, and is aimed at radio sales people, media strategists, advertisers and marketers.
 
Expect a panel debate and discussion on multi-channel campaigns and technology and the latest creative trends in radio advertising; Neil Higgs from TNS Research Surveys will give a presentation of the latest research on what SA’s big advertising spenders really think of radio and the value that it offers; and the event will wrap up with an in-depth debate on how to bridge the chasm between advertisers and programmers.
